Cost to Replace Gutters and Downpipes

The cost of replacing downpipes and gutters is determined by a number of factors. These include the size of the gutter system, the material and whether it includes gutter guards.

Gutter systems help to direct water away from the house to prevent soil erosion, basement flooding and staining of brick and siding. They also help prevent ice damage and decaying fascia.

Materials


Gutter and downspout systems safeguard the foundation of a home from water damage. They divert excess water away from the siding and roof to prevent structural damage. They are important in preventing foundation failure, basement flooding and erosion. Gutter maintenance includes cleaning and replacing damaged or blocked gutters on a regular basis.

Gutters and downspouts are available in different materials, including galvanized steel, copper, and aluminum. Each has its own advantages and disadvantages. Choose the type that best meets your requirements based on its durability, cost, and maintenance requirements. Other factors to consider include the design and color of the downspouts and gutters, and how they will match with your home's exterior.

The main cause of gutter failure is the clogs that are caused by shingle grit, leaves, and pine needles. If these clogs are present, the rainwater cannot pass through the gutter, and is forced to flow over the soffit's sides and fascia. This can cause rot, mold, and sagging. In certain instances the water may overflow into the gutters and then pool close to the foundation.

Downspouts should be able to discharge water at least 4 to 6 feet away from the foundation. They should also be constructed with a slope to stop the accumulation of soil and other debris near the foundation of the house. If the grading isn't ideal you can install a downspout extension to divert the water away. They are available in various lengths and prices.

The gutter system should be sealed to stop water from getting into the seams and joints which can cause corrosion or rust. A silicone sealant is a great option and is available in most hardware stores. Additionally, a metal flashing can be affixed to the wall to protect the structure from water damage.

Downspouts

Gutters are only as efficient as their downspouts which allow the collected water to go away from your foundation to prevent foundation problems and soil erosion. Downspouts are usually made from the same material as the gutter system and come in a variety of styles and colors to match the aesthetics of your home. They are typically round but they could also be square or rectangular to accommodate different roofs. They have features that help direct the discharged water. For example, they may have a slight bend on the bottom or a diverter that could be connected to an underground drain, a runoff water drain, or a rain-barrel.

Gutter downspouts can be clogged with debris, such as leaves or twigs as well as pebbles and that is why they need to be regularly cleaned and checked for leaks and rust. A gutter company will inspect your downspouts and make any necessary repairs to ensure they function correctly. They can also recommend the extension of your downspout and other drainage systems that help better manage the flow in areas that experience frequent heavy rain.

When deciding on the number of downspouts are needed, think about the pitch of your roof as well as the average rainfall for your area. The rule of thumb is to have one downspout for every 40 feet of gutter. This will help prevent obstructions, overflow, and flooding damage. It's best to install more downspouts if you live in an area with frequent rainfall.

Downspouts come in various materials, including vinyl (PVC), galvanized steel, aluminum, and copper. The most durable downspouts are, lightweight and weather resistant. Look for downspouts with a smooth, curved, surface to avoid clogging or corrosion. Installing them should be easy. Heat tape

Gutter systems are an important element of your home's drainage. They channel rainwater away from your home and help prevent damage from water. However, gutters are subject to wear and tear due to exposure to the elements, temperature variations and accumulation of debris. Regularly inspecting and cleaning your gutters is the best way to keep them in good condition. If you find that your gutters leak, it's time to consider replacing them.

To repair leaky gutters, you can seal the seams with an exclusive gutter sealant. This is available at home centers, lumberyards and full-service hardware stores. To ensure that the sealant is applied correctly it is recommended to use a caulking gun to apply the sealant. The sealant must be applied on both sides of the gutters to stop water from getting away and damaging the exterior of your house and foundation.

After you've bought your gutters and downpipes it is crucial to make sure they're installed correctly. First, you need to take measurements from the corner of your home to the location of your downspout. The downspout must be at least four feet from the foundation of your house and free of any obstructions like electric meters hose-bibs or sidewalks.

Then, install the downpipes by connecting them to the gutters using elbows and connectors. You can also install a stub for the downpipe in case you want to connect the downpipe to a waterbutt to harvest rainwater.
